
Installing fiber cement panels: what to know
Fiber cement siding comes in a number of shapes and sizes, and panels are one of the most versatile and cost-effective of these products. They work well where plywood, OSB, or T-111 have historically been used -- sheds, board and batten siding and Tudor-style siding. Manufactured in four-foot widths and eight-, nine- and ten-foot lengths, the panels come in various textures that include wood grain, stucco, grooved -- to mimic T-111 -- and smooth. Smooth panels with metal extrusions create a sleek, modern look and are gaining in popularity.
Matters of aesthetics
Unlike many wood panels, fiber cement panels are square edge -- meaning they do not have a tongue-and-groove or shiplap edge. It seems like a minor detail, but unlike wood, the fiber cement panel requires two rows of nails at the joint, which makes addressing the joints somewhat of a challenge depending on the look you are aiming for.
You have a number of ways to finish the joints including the following:
- Butting the panels tight. When aesthetics are less of a concern, butting the panels together is probably acceptable. To help improve appearance, take care to line the fasteners up straight, and be very careful not to over drive the fasteners.
- Using batten strips to cover the fasteners. If you are going for a cleaner look, one in which the fasteners are covered, try batten strips. The battens lie over the fasteners completely concealing them. Battens can be arranged horizontally and vertically to your liking.
- Using some type of joiner, such as a metal extrusion. Joiners can be used to both express the joints and to conceal the fasteners, but they only cover the fasteners at the edges of the panels. Joiners made of extruded metal are common in applications with a modern aesthetic.
Panel installation tips
Before you install fiber cement siding panels, review these four tips:
- The panels are heavy; a 4-by-8 panel weighs nearly 75 lbs. Consider panel installation a two-person job.
- Think about what the layout will look like on the building. Hanging the panels is a little like setting tile -- but on a much bigger scale. Aim to avoid having small pieces left over -- they can be a real challenge to integrate pleasingly into the design. Spending time early on to get the layout right can prevent headaches down the road.
- Consider the fasteners and fastener schedule. Fiber cement panels have separate fastening schedules based on local wind load requirements, fastener type, frame type, and the height of the building. There is no one-size-fits-all fastener schedule. Consult www.jameshardie.com for the correct schedule.
- The framing of the building might need some enhancements. When the panels join, it can be difficult to line up two rows of fasteners onto a 1½-inch stud. Adding another stud at the joints is a simple way to ensure the panels are securely fastened. For complete installation instructions, visit www.jameshardie.com.
With a little patience and forethought, you should be able to create some amazing panelized designs.
